Literacy & Inquiry
At Maeroa Intermediate, learning in our classrooms is built on a knowledge-rich curriculum. This means students are exposed to a wide range of ideas, stories, and concepts that grow their understanding of the world and help them make meaningful connections across subjects.
Literacy sits at the heart of our learning. Reading and writing are not taught in isolation; instead, they are woven into real contexts. Students might explore history through diaries and letters, investigate science by reading articles and reports, or connect with the arts through poetry and stories. In every subject, students are encouraged to read widely, expand their vocabulary, and express their ideas in clear and effective ways.
At the same time, we make sure the foundations are strong. Key literacy skills—such as sentence structure, grammar, comprehension, and critical thinking—are taught explicitly. This balance means students develop the tools they need to succeed while also experiencing the excitement of learning through rich content.
In our classrooms, knowledge and skills work hand in hand. Students become confident readers, writers, and thinkers, prepared not only to excel in school but also to participate in conversations and opportunities beyond the classroom.


Maths
At Maeroa Intermediate, mathematics learning is designed to make sense of the world by moving from concrete to abstract thinking. Students begin with hands-on experiences using materials, diagrams, and real-life contexts to explore number, algebra, geometry, measurement, and statistics. These practical activities help them see how maths works in everyday life and give meaning to the symbols and processes they will use later.
A strong emphasis is placed on basic facts knowledge—knowing addition, subtraction, multiplication, and division facts quickly and accurately. These form the building blocks that allow students to tackle more complex problems with confidence.
We also believe in the power of explicit teaching. Teachers carefully model strategies, explain steps clearly, and guide students as they practise and apply their learning. By combining concrete experiences, strong foundations, and clear instruction, students grow into confident problem-solvers who can think flexibly and use maths in many different situations.
